Generalized, Floating and Self Adjoint Differential Voltage Current Conveyor
Ahmed, M. Soliman

Abstract: A new building block defined as the Generalized Differential Voltage Current Conveyor (GDVCC) with three Y inputs and three Z outputs is defined. The new building block has the simultaneous properties of being floating as well as a self-adjoint. The pathological representation of the GDVCC with its Nodal Admittance Matrix (NAM) stamp is given. The CMOS circuit realizing the GDVCC is also included. It is founded that among all the current conveyor (CCII) family included in this study the CCII- and the GDVCC are the only two elements that are floating as well as self adjoint.
